Windows Server 2022 和 Windows Server 2019 都是微软推出的服务器操作系统,适用于企业级生产环境。选择哪一个更适合你的生产环境,取决于你的具体需求、硬件条件、安全要求以及对新功能的接受程度。以下是两者的详细对比,帮助你做出决策:
一、核心差异概览
| 特性 | Windows Server 2019 | Windows Server 2022 |
|---|---|---|
| 发布时间 | 2018年(正式版) | 2021年 |
| 支持周期(主流支持) | 至2024年1月9日 | 至2026年10月13日(长期支持) |
| 安全性增强 | 基础防护(如Host Guardian、Shielded VMs) | 更强的安全机制(如Secured-core server、TLS 1.3、HVCI增强) |
| 网络功能 | SDN基础支持 | 改进的SDN、DNS over HTTPS(DoH)、QUIC支持 |
| 存储和文件服务 | Storage Spaces Direct, ReFS v1.2 | ReFS v2.0,增强的存储复制性能 |
| 容器与云集成 | 支持Docker、Kubernetes(有限) | 更好地支持容器、Azure Arc、混合云集成 |
| 内核优化 | 基于Windows 10 1809 | 基于Windows 10 21H2 / Windows 11 同代内核 |
| .NET 支持 | 较旧版本 | 更新的运行时和开发工具支持 |
二、关键维度对比
1. 安全性
- Windows Server 2022 明显胜出:
- 默认启用 安全核心服务器(Secured-core server),防范固件级攻击。
- 支持 TLS 1.3,提升通信加密强度。
- 增强的 虚拟化安全(HVCI in VMs),内存完整性保护更完善。
- 更严格的默认配置(如关闭不必要的服务)。
✅ 推荐:对X_X、X_X、X_X等高安全要求行业,优先选 2022。
2. 稳定性与成熟度
- Windows Server 2019 更成熟:
- 已广泛部署多年,大量企业验证过其稳定性。
- 第三方软件兼容性更好,尤其是一些老旧应用或专用系统。
- Bug 和补丁问题相对较少。
⚠️ 注意:虽然 2022 已发布数年,但在某些小众软硬件环境中仍可能存在兼容性问题。
3. 性能与资源利用
- 两者性能相近,但 Server 2022 在以下方面有优势:
- 更高效的 TCP/IP 栈(支持 DoH、QUIC),适合现代Web服务。
- 存储复制延迟更低,ReFS 文件系统更稳定(v2.0)。
- 更好的容器支持(镜像更小、启动更快)。
4. 云与混合环境集成
- Server 2022 更适合混合云和 Azure 集成:
- 原生支持 Azure Arc、Azure Automanage。
- 更好的身份管理(与 Azure AD 集成更紧密)。
- 支持 Confidential VMs(机密虚拟机)用于敏感数据处理。
✅ 若使用 Azure 或计划上云,推荐 2022。
5. 生命周期与支持
- Server 2019 主流支持将于 2024年1月结束,之后仅提供扩展安全更新(需付费)。
- Server 2022 将获得支持至 2031年(扩展支持结束),更适合长期部署。
🔚 如果你现在部署新系统,建议避免即将停止支持的操作系统。
三、适用场景建议
| 场景 | 推荐版本 | 原因 |
|---|---|---|
| 新建数据中心或云环境 | ✅ Windows Server 2022 | 更长支持周期、更强安全性、更好云集成 |
| 运行关键业务的老系统升级 | ✅/⚠️ 视情况而定 | 若应用兼容性良好,推荐升级到 2022;否则可暂用 2019 |
| 高安全性要求(如X_X、X_X) | ✅ Windows Server 2022 | TLS 1.3、Secured-core、HVCI 等高级防护 |
| 使用较老的应用或驱动 | ⚠️ Windows Server 2019 | 兼容性更佳,减少迁移风险 |
| 短期项目或测试环境 | ✅ Windows Server 2022 | 可体验新功能,为未来做准备 |
四、结论:哪个更适合生产环境?
🟢 总体推荐:Windows Server 2022
除非你有明确的兼容性限制或必须依赖某个仅支持 2019 的旧软件,Windows Server 2022 是当前更优的选择,特别是在以下情况下:
- 新部署的生产环境
- 对安全性要求较高
- 计划使用 Azure 或混合云
- 希望获得长期支持(至2031年)
🟡 例外情况选择 Windows Server 2019:
- 当前环境已稳定运行 2019,且无升级必要
- 关键应用尚未认证支持 2022
- 技术团队对 2022 缺乏经验,需过渡期
五、建议行动步骤
- 评估现有应用和硬件兼容性(使用 Microsoft Assessment and Planning Toolkit)
- 在测试环境中部署 Server 2022,验证关键服务
- 制定升级计划,逐步迁移到 2022
- 启用安全功能(如 Secured-core、BitLocker、Windows Defender ATP)
✅ 总结一句话:
对于大多数新的或计划长期运行的生产环境,Windows Server 2022 是更先进、更安全、更可持续的选择,应作为首选。
云小栈